Star Wars Armada :

Registration opens: 9am Friday 2nd June

First round starts: 11am Friday 2nd June. 4 Rounds planned on Day 1

Day two registration opens: 8am Saturday 3rd June

Round 5 starts: 10am. 4 rounds are scheduled on Day 2

Day three registration starts: 8am Sunday 4th June for the top 4.

Top 16 begins at 10am
